What is a Transponder Key?


A transponder key is a key with an integrated chip that utilizes radio-frequency recognition (RFID) innovation to interact with the vehicle. When the key is placed into the ignition, it sends out a distinct code to the ECU. If the code matches the one stored in the ECU, the engine starts; if not, the vehicle remains paralyzed, deterring theft.

Why Programming is Necessary


Programming transponder keys is essential due to their unique coding system. Each transponder key has a particular code appointed to it, enabling only programmed keys to start the vehicle. When a brand-new key is produced or an existing one is duplicated, it should undergo programming to synchronize with the vehicle's ECU.

Steps to Program Transponder Keys


The process of programming transponder keys can differ depending on the vehicle make and design. Nevertheless, the following basic steps provide a fundamental framework:

  1. Gather Necessary Tools: Ensure all tools and keys are at hand.
  2. Access the OBD-II Port: Locate the OBD-II port in the vehicle (generally under the control panel).
  3. Link the Key Programmer: Use the key programming gadget to link to the vehicle's ECU.
  4. Select the Vehicle Model: Input the make and design of the vehicle into the programming gadget.
  5. Neglect for Prior Keys: If programming a new key, disable formerly programmed keys if essential (this might be needed for particular makes).
  6. Insert the New Key: Place the brand-new transponder type in the ignition.
  7. Follow Device Prompts: Follow the on-screen guidelines on the key programming device.
  8. Evaluate the Key: After programming, test the key by attempting to start the vehicle.
